Given our Michigan winters, common issues include problems with the electrical system (like window regulators and sensors) due to road salt corrosion, as well as suspension wear from potholes. Turbocharger and direct fuel injection carbon buildup are also frequent concerns across many VW models.
Look for a shop with Volkswagen-specific diagnostic tools and certified technicians, as VWs require specialized knowledge. Check reviews for local shops that mention expertise with German cars, and ask if they use original equipment (OEM) or high-quality aftermarket parts to ensure longevity.
Seek service immediately if the light is flashing or if you notice a loss of power, as this could indicate a serious issue. For a steady light, schedule a diagnostic scan promptly, as ignoring it can lead to more costly repairs, especially with our variable climate affecting engine performance.
While specialized VW repair may have a higher labor rate due to expertise, it often proves cost-effective by ensuring correct diagnoses and preventing repeat issues. Using a specialist avoids the risk of improper repairs from shops unfamiliar with VW's complex systems.
The seasonal extremes require special attention to battery health, tire condition (consider winter tires), and undercarriage washes to combat salt corrosion. Also, prepare for "pothole season" by having your suspension and alignment checked regularly to prevent uneven tire wear and damage.
